Background

ENGIE is a major player in the energy transition whose purpose is to accelerate the transition towards a carbon‑neutral economy. With 98 000 employees in 30 countries the Group covers the entire energy value chain from production to infrastructures and sales. ENGIE combines complementary activities: renewable electricity and green gas production, flexibility assets (notably batteries), gas and electricity transmission and distribution networks, local energy infrastructures and the supply of energy to individuals, local authorities and businesses.

Every year ENGIE works to drive forward the energy transition and achieve its net‑zero carbon goal by 2045. The Group has been present in Africa for over 50 years.

ENGIE provides expertise in four (4) Global Business Units:

  • Renewables & Flex Power – Delivering greener and smarter electrons through renewable energy and flexible power solutions.
  • Local Energy Infrastructures – Supporting customers in achieving significant decarbonisation goals.
  • Networks – Expanding and adapting power and gas infrastructure to accommodate the transition to green molecules.
  • Supply & Energy Management – Leveraging ENGIE’s global energy assets to deliver secure sustainable energy to customers.
About ENGIE in South Africa
  • 15 years presence in South Africa
  • First and largest Independent Power Producer (IPP) with more than 16 GW in operation
  • Over 300 professionals
  • Developed, built and operated the first H₂ plant in Africa at Mogalakwena mine
  • Founding member of the Hydrogen Valley initiative with Anglo American and the Department of Science and Technology
  • Operational and Safety excellence across all sites
  • Growth Market for ENGIE
Operational Assets in South Africa
  • Avon & Dedisa Peaking Power (1005 MW OCGT)
  • Xina Solar One (100 MW CSP)
  • Kathu Solar Park (100 MW CSP)
  • Aurora Wind (95 MW Onshore Wind)
  • Golden Valley (117 MW Onshore Wind)
  • Excelsior (32 MW Onshore Wind)
  • Konkoonsies 2 (75 MW Solar PV)
  • Aggeneys (40 MW Solar PV)
  • MBP (75 MW Solar PV)
  • Grootspruit (75 MW Solar PV) – in construction
  • Graspan (75 MW Solar PV) – in construction
  • OYA Hybrid (333 MW Solar/Wind/BESS) – in construction
Preamble

Kathu Operations is a 100 MW greenfield Concentrated Solar Power (CSP) project with parabolic trough technology and a molten‑salt storage system that allows 4.5 hours of thermal energy storage, limiting the intermittent nature of solar energy.

Key Responsibilities & Purpose of the Job
  • Ensure safe, reliable, efficient and cost‑effective operation of all electrical systems and assets at the plant.
  • Apply best, safest, sustainable and timely maintenance practices to achieve plant operational targets.
  • Maintain compliance with electrical engineering standards, safety regulations and company procedures.
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ives to maximize plant availability and minimize downtime.
  • Provide technical leadership and coordination of electrical maintenance activities.
Main Activities
  • Evaluate electrical systems, designs and installations.
  • Ensure availability and reliability of electrical assets through effective maintenance.
  • Perform risk assessments and ensure compliance with safety standards and regulations.
  • Lead, supervise and coordinate electrical technicians (direct hires and contractors).
  • Ensure compliance with maintenance plans, Maximo CMMS procedures and O&M requirements.
  • Supervise all electrical equipment on site, including routine maintenance, troubleshooting, repairs, modifications and fabrication work.
  • Analyze and resolve complex electrical engineering issues related to equipment failures and system inefficiencies.
  • Review vendor documentation, maintenance manuals and spare parts lists.
  • Draft and update electrical procedures required for plant operations.
  • Participate in Maximo (CMMS) development, implementation and ongoing optimisation.
  • Ensure electrical maintenance activities comply with company standards, specifications, OEM recommendations and contract terms.
